What companies run services between Cardiff, Wales and Appledore, Devon, England?

You can take a train from Cardiff Central to Down Road via Bristol Temple Meads, Exeter St Davids, Barnstaple, and Rail Station in around 4h 32m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Kingsway GD to Down Road via Bus Station and Bus Station in around 6h 17m.
